【正文】
在IT行业中,网页设计与开发是一项关键技能,尤其在互联网企业中更是不可或缺。本项目名为"仿小米网站 html",旨在通过HTML语言来复刻小米官方网站的部分页面,以此学习和掌握网页布局、元素设计以及响应式网页开发等核心概念。下面将详细介绍这个项目涉及的关键知识点。
1. HTML基础:
HTML(HyperText Markup Language)是网页内容的结构化标记语言,用于定义网页的结构和内容。在这个项目中,开发者会学习到如`<head>`、`<body>`、`<header>`、`<nav>`、`<section>`、`<article>`、`<footer>`等基本标签,以及如何使用`<img>`、`<a>`、`<h1>`-`<h6>`、`<p>`等元素来构建网页的各个部分。
2. CSS样式:
为了实现小米网站的视觉效果,开发者需要熟悉CSS(Cascading Style Sheets)语言。CSS用于控制网页的布局和样式,包括颜色、字体、尺寸、位置等。在“仿小米网站 html”项目中,开发者将运用选择器(如类选择器 `.class`、ID选择器 `#id`、元素选择器 `element`等)、盒模型(margin、padding、border、content)、浮动布局、定位(static、relative、absolute、fixed)以及过渡、动画等技巧。
3. 响应式设计:
响应式网页设计是确保网页在不同设备和屏幕尺寸上都能良好显示的关键技术。开发者需要学习使用媒体查询(`@media`)来针对不同设备设置不同的CSS规则,同时理解流式布局(flexbox)和网格系统(grid)的运用,以适应各种屏幕尺寸。
4. 小米网站特点分析:
小米网站的设计风格简约且功能性强,注重用户体验。开发者需要分析其色彩搭配、字体选择、导航栏设计、产品展示方式等元素,并在HTML结构和CSS样式中体现这些特点。例如,小米网站常采用白色背景和淡色文字,突出产品图片,使用清晰的导航结构,以及动态加载和交互效果。
5. 实践与调试:
通过实际编写代码并不断调整,开发者可以加深对HTML和CSS的理解,学习使用浏览器的开发者工具进行实时调试和查看元素样式,这对于提升问题解决能力和优化页面性能至关重要。
6. 文件组织:
在“xiaomi”这个压缩包中,可能包含一系列HTML文件,分别对应小米网站的不同页面或部分。合理的文件组织结构可以帮助开发者更好地管理代码,提高工作效率。
“仿小米网站 html”项目是一个综合性的学习实践,涵盖了从基础HTML结构到高级CSS样式和响应式设计等多个方面,对于提升网页开发者的技能和实践经验具有重要意义。通过这个项目,开发者不仅可以掌握网页制作的基本技能,还能了解到如何将理论知识应用到实际项目中,以创建符合现代标准的网页。
评论0
最新资源